History
1967 Vintage: half a century of history in a bottle. This Banyuls Traditionnel comes from the heroic vineyards of the Côte Vermeille, clinging to the schist terraces overlooking the Mediterranean. A symbol of the perseverance of the winemakers at the Cave de l’Étoile, it reflects expertise passed down from generation to generation since 1921.
Vinification
Made predominantly from Grenache Noir, complemented by Grenache Gris and Carignan, this vin doux naturel was produced by fortification (mutage) on the skins after prolonged maceration, followed by extended oxidative aging in old casks and barrels. Decades spent under wood have shaped a unique aromatic profile, worthy of the finest collectible Banyuls.
Tasting Notes
Amber-copper robe opens to a powerful nose of dried fruits, prunes, and figs, accented by cocoa, coffee, and spices. The palate is broad and warm, expressing noble rancio with notes of walnut and leather, balanced by unexpected freshness. A long and elegant finish makes this 1967 a prestigious bottle, ideal with aged Comté, dark chocolate desserts, or as an exceptional oenological gift.
